Back to EpisodesIn a stadium full of Breakers---Nebraska baseball can’t get past the likes of Ole Miss and Arizona State, as their season ended on Sunday

-Nebraska took care of South Dakota State, 4-1, on Friday; sending them to the Winner’s Bracket, where they played Ole Miss on
Saturday—who got there by outlasting Arizona State, 7-6, on Friday night (ending at 1:15am)
-Saturday’s game started promising for Nebraska in front of a massive, juiced-up crowd—Ty Horn was masterful with 9 strikeouts but
got in trouble in the 6 th inning, ending with 120 pitches and 3 runs allowed. Nebraska lost that game, 6-3…before falling behind
yesterday by 10 runs at battling back to an 11-8 loss to Arizona State…Jake was on the scene all 3 games
